20 ## -*- texinfo -*- |
|
21 ## @deftypefn {Function File} {} asctime (@var{tm_struct}) |
|
22 ## Convert a time structure to a string using the following five-field |
|
23 ## format: Thu Mar 28 08:40:14 1996. For example, |
3426
|
24 ## |
3301
|
25 ## @example |
|
26 ## @group |
7097
|
27 ## asctime (localtime (time ())) |
3301
|
28 ## @result{} "Mon Feb 17 01:15:06 1997\n" |
|
29 ## @end group |
|
30 ## @end example |
3426
|
31 ## |
3301
|
32 ## This is equivalent to @code{ctime (time ())}. |
|
33 ## @end deftypefn |
